Goddess Magic by Aurora Kane
A Handbook of Spells, Charms, and Potions Divine in Origin

Drawing down the moon is something I have done to take in the Goddess but have never done this with a specific goddess in mind, invoked or evoked. This book feels like an introduction with a bit about many goddesses, their powers and offerings they might like. The book suggests researching the goddesses in this book, finding a few that will enhance your life or magic working, incorporating intention, setting up an altar, believing, taking into consideration doing no harm, being patient as you listen and wait, and then being thankful. As mentioned, this feels introductory in nature and a good place to begin as one explores the realm of goddesses, how to know them better, incorporate them in one’s life and magic working.

What a disaster. Usually I specify my critiques, but there are so many I can't wrap my head around where to even begin. Basically this book is an ungrounded mess of seriously questionable (if not completely inaccurate) information, presents Wiccan ideas as witchcraft, and uses a binary gender framework to describe plant energies.

Speaking of which, if I see the word "energy" one more time, I'll combust.
